Apache新手教程:使用mod_lbmethod_bytraffic设置Apache

Apache新手教程:使用mod_lbmethod_bytraffic设置Apache

Apache是一种流行的开源Web服务器软件,被广泛用于搭建和管理网站。在使用Apache时,我们可以通过使用不同的模块来扩展其功能。其中一个有用的模块是mod_lbmethod_bytraffic,它可以帮助我们设置Apache服务器的负载均衡策略。

什么是负载均衡?

负载均衡是一种将网络流量分配到多个服务器上的技术。通过将流量分散到多个服务器上,负载均衡可以提高网站的性能和可靠性。当一个服务器无法处理所有的请求时,负载均衡可以将请求转发到其他可用的服务器上,从而避免单点故障。

安装mod_lbmethod_bytraffic模块

要使用mod_lbmethod_bytraffic模块,首先需要确保已经安装了Apache服务器。然后,按照以下步骤安装和启用该模块:

  1. 打开终端或命令提示符。
  2. 使用适合您的操作系统的包管理器安装Apache的开发工具包。
  3. 运行以下命令启用mod_lbmethod_bytraffic模块:
sudo a2enmod lbmethod_bytraffic

完成上述步骤后,mod_lbmethod_bytraffic模块将被启用并可用于配置Apache服务器的负载均衡策略。

配置负载均衡策略

一旦mod_lbmethod_bytraffic模块已经启用,我们可以通过编辑Apache的配置文件来配置负载均衡策略。以下是一个示例配置:

<VirtualHost *:80>
  ServerName example.com
  DocumentRoot /var/www/html

  <Proxy balancer://mycluster>
    BalancerMember http://192.168.1.101:8080
    BalancerMember http://192.168.1.102:8080
    BalancerMember http://192.168.1.103:8080
    ProxySet lbmethod=bytraffic
  </Proxy>

  ProxyPass / balancer://mycluster/
  ProxyPassReverse / balancer://mycluster/
</VirtualHost>

在上面的示例中,我们创建了一个名为”mycluster”的负载均衡集群,并将三个服务器添加为成员。”lbmethod=bytraffic”指定了使用mod_lbmethod_bytraffic模块来进行负载均衡。

重启Apache服务器

完成配置后,我们需要重启Apache服务器以使更改生效。运行以下命令来重启Apache:

sudo service apache2 restart

现在,Apache服务器将使用mod_lbmethod_bytraffic模块来进行负载均衡,从而提高网站的性能和可靠性。

总结

通过使用mod_lbmethod_bytraffic模块,我们可以轻松地配置Apache服务器的负载均衡策略。负载均衡可以提高网站的性能和可靠性,确保在服务器故障或高流量情况下仍然能够正常运行。如果您正在寻找一个可靠的云服务器提供商,树叶云是一个不错的选择。他们提供香港服务器、美国服务器和云服务器,可以满足您的不同需求。

了解更多关于树叶云的信息,请访问官网:https://shuyeidc.com

香港服务器首选树叶云,提供高性能和可靠性的服务器解决方案。您可以通过访问https://shuyeidc.com了解更多关于10元香港服务器和香港服务器免费试用的信息。

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/153660.html<

(0)
运维的头像运维
上一篇2025-03-14 14:48
下一篇 2025-03-14 14:49

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注